Planning a train journey from Leamington Spa to Stourbridge Junction? The trip usually takes about 1hrs 27 mins, covering approximately 27 miles (44 kilometres). With roughly 38 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£14.80,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

The station is well-prepared to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office operates extensively from early morning until late in the evening. For those purchasing and collecting tickets online, accessible ticket machines are readily available on site, alongside smartcard services. Step-free access features largely here, affirming the station's commitment to accessibility. Notably, while there are no accessible toilets within the station, standard toilets can be found on platforms 2 and 3.
Looking for refreshment? A coffee shop, a buffet, and other dining options provide sustenance while waiting for your train. For something to read on your journey, a kiosk and newsagent are at your disposal. And, should you require cash, an ATM is conveniently located in the ticket office area.
Leamington Spa is not just limited to rail connectivity; it provides ample options for onward travel as well. Rail replacement bus services can be found on Old Warwick Road right outside the station, ensuring continuity of your journey when rail lines are undergoing maintenance. Taxis are also readily available at the station entrance. If bus travel is your preference, you can plan your journey in advance with the available printable timetables here.

The station boasts a wide range of facilities designed to enhance your travel experience. For those looking to purchase tickets, the station houses a ticket office that is open from 06:00 to 20:00 Monday through Saturday and from 09:00 to 19:00 on Sundays. If you have pre-purchased tickets online, you can easily collect them from the station's accessible ticket machines. Additionally, the station is equipped with induction loops to aid those with hearing impairments.
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access available throughout the station, ensuring ease of travel for all passengers. The station lacks a first-class lounge but offers a seating area for commuters. Furthermore, although there are no shops or currency exchange facilities on-site, passengers can enjoy refreshments from a coffee kiosk and food vending machines.
Stourbridge Junction's connectivity doesn't stop at the train lines. The station serves as a crucial transit point with a plethora of links to other transport modes. If rail service disruptions occur, a rail replacement service will operate from the bus stop located in the station car park. For those traveling by taxi, several nearby taxi services, such as ABM and Eagle, ensure you're never left stranded. Additionally, local bus services provide a seamless connection for onward travel, with information readily available for download in a printable format.
